GasBuddy releases 2024 fuel price outlook, suggesting lower costs

GasBuddy expects the yearly annual average to decrease from $3.51 per gallon, to $3.38 per gallon in 2024.

DALLAS — GasBuddy is prepping for the new year with its annual Fuel Price Outlook. For 2024, they are forecasting that drivers will see relief at the pump. 

After two years of above average gas prices across the nation, GasBuddy expects the yearly annual average will drop from $3.51 per gallon, to $3.38 per gallon in 2024. 

Patrick De Haan, the head of petroleum analysis for GasBuddy, said he is "hopeful" $5 and $6 prices at the pump for gasoline and diesel will "also fade into memory."

"The global refining picture continues to improve, providing more capacity and peace of mind that record-setting prices will stay away from the pump in 2024. I anticipate that we'll still have some volatility, unexpected outages and disruptions, and potentially weather-related issues, but I do not expect it to lead to record prices," De Haan said. "Offsetting OPEC+'s production cuts is contributing to the rise of U.S. oil production, which now stands at record levels. Combined with Canada, North American oil production could further stabilize countries that have decided to curb oil production."

Some highlights from GasBuddy's annual fuel outlook, released Thursday:

  • Gas prices have potential to fall below the national average of $3 per gallon this winter, with a possible rise in late-February. As summer approaches, $4 per gallon may be seen. 
  • Some Californian cities could see prices above $6 per gallon if refinery issues develop during the summer. Most major U.S. cities will see prices peak or slightly below $4 per gallon in 2024.
  • Americans are expected to spend a combined $446.9 billion on gasoline in 2024. 
  • Electric vehicles, or EVs, and the 2024 presidential election has potential to impact fuel prices, with a possible slowdown of the EV transition. 
  • Memorial Day will be the priciest 2024 holiday at the pump. The national average price of gas is expected to be $3.56-$4.04 on the holiday.
